Professional Career Summary
| September 1, 1982 | Joined Bayer AG (Toxicology Institute, Pharma Research Center Wuppertal, Germany) | | 1982 – 1985 | Lab head and study director for non-rodent studies in Toxicology Institute Conducted non-rodent studies (dogs, monkeys, mini-pigs), generated toxicological data to support development and registration of pharmaceutical drugs. | | 1986 – 1990 | Scientific coordinator in Toxicology Institute Coordinated all study activities within Toxicology Institute. Recommended implementation of new technologies in toxicological testing strategies. Initiated continuous improvement processes and "lessons learned" activities. | | 1991 – 2002 | Senior Director, Global Head of Toxicology-Pharma Directed the activities of Pharma Toxicology functions. Functional and operational responsibility for all Pharma Toxicology units (120 full-time employees) | | 2002 - 2007 | Vice President, Global Head HealthCare Toxicology Directed global activities of all toxicology functions (General Toxicology, Pathology and Clinical Pathology, Molecular and Special Toxicology, Genotoxicity and Carcinogenicity. Functional and operational responsibility for all HealthCare Toxicology Units (250 full-time) employees.
| | 2007 to present | Senior Vice President, Head Global Early Development Directs global activities of all preclinical development functions (Toxicology, Safety Pharmacology, DMPK, Animal Management). Functional and operational responsibility for all preclinical units at Bayer HealthCare (500 full-time emplyoees). |
